Xiongnu
Meanings
noun
- An ancient nomadic-based people that formed a state or confederation north of the agriculture-based empire of the Han dynasty.

Etymology
Borrowed from the Hanyu Pinyin romanization of Mandarin 匈奴 (Xiōngnú). Possibly a doublet of Hun; their relationship to the Huns is disputed.
